Description
Homes for Youth's mission is to provide stable, safe, and appropriate homes for up to 5 foster children in each house. It has provided a home for up to 5 homeless teenagers at a time, delivering services such as adequate kitchen and dining facilities, maintenance and repair coverage for the home. In addition, it has facilitated foster parent training through a video conferencing system with the Henderson County Department of Social Services. Currently owning one house, Homes for Youth is actively planning for a second house.

Program areas at Homes for Youth

Provided a home for up to 5 homeless teenagers at a time overseen by foster parents. Services delivered include providing a house with living space, bedrooms, and adequate kitchen and dining facilities, and also providing maintenance and repair coverage for the home. The organization supported other needs of the foster parents and children as they arose. The organization also provided a video conferencing system for foster parent training conducted by the county department of social services.
